Output c90e85c20dc663a852dae7e30fd53b69ad05638bdd8d02eae9de52b4afcdb124:1

value
2123054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0252669cac194c3d7531b15b79e801f168825425 OP_EQUAL
address
31uHzEicWa4g23nRWZckaZxiqmsYmnZGo8
transaction
c90e85c20dc663a852dae7e30fd53b69ad05638bdd8d02eae9de52b4afcdb124
spent
true